Application
Trimethyl phosphite is an organophosphorus ester with flame retardant property. It is generally used as a ligand to form coordinate complexes with transition metals.
Some of its other applications include:

- For N-alkylation of amino-9,10-anthraquinones in imidazolium-based ionic liquids without the use of base and highly polar organic solvents.
- To synthesize dimethyl phenylphosphonate by reacting with phenyl radical generated by the thermal decomposition of phenylazotriphenylmethane (PAT).
- To synthesize aryl phosphonates via P-arylation reaction with silyl triflates.
